[During the 72 days following the crash,
the survivors suffered from extreme hardships,
including exposure, starvation and several avalanches,
which led to the deaths of 13 more passengers.
The remaining passengers resorted to
cannibalism to survive.
As the weather improved with the arrival
of late spring, two survivors, Nando Parrado
and Roberto Canessa,
climbed the 4,650-metre (15,260 ft) mountain peak
on the western rim of the glacier cirque
without any mountaineering gear.
They hiked for 10 days into Chile,
traveling 61 kilometres (38 mi),
before finding help.
On 23 December 1972, two and a half months
after the crash, the 16 remaining
survivors were rescued.]
